What are the responsibilities and job description for the Program Supervisor, Hybrid position at Catapult Learning?
Manages the Catapult Learning instructional program to insure adherence to Catapult Learning educational standards; hires, trains and oversees the performance of teachers and assistants where applicable, assists with testing students, and oversees the conferencing of students, principals, classroom teachers and parents. Works closely with the Education Quality Department to ensure the implementation of quality programming. Ensures customer satisfaction through problem solving and frequent communication.

Operational Responsibilities:
- Assure customer satisfaction, program quality assurance, and student achievement.
- Manages concerns regarding instructional needs, materials and supplies.
- Communicates with school principal and classroom teachers concerning program implementation.
- Ensures customer service and program problems are communicated to the Regional Director or senior management immediately.
- Communicate with the regional education quality manager regarding instructional issues and concerns.
- Establishes a positive professional rapport with school staff, principals, and the school district.
- Continues to grow the program and work towards renewal of contracts.
- Oversees the organization and management of the program library. Recommends, purchases, and maintains materials and supplies.
- Thorough communication with Regional Director to assure safety and professional appearance of optimal learning environment of Catapult Learning classrooms.
- Responsible for preparing teachers to successfully complete their quality assurance review and assuring that all teachers complete Catapult Learning teacher training component.
- Submits Monthly Reports to Regional Directors and Regional Educational Quality Managers, and other documents as necessary.
- Other duties may be assigned.
Supervisory Responsibilities:
- Trains and supervises teachers. Supervision to include informal and formal lesson observations (formal to include Pre/PEP-conference, scheduled lesson observations and post-conference).
- Provides assistance to teachers in the development of class schedules and instructional strategies to meet the needs of all participating students.
- Prepares presentations for meetings and trainings to address both instructional and business issues as required by the Regional Director and Instructional Support.
- Assist teachers with the completion and submission of company, district, state, or federal required forms.
- Provides guidance to teachers with record keeping procedures and ensures that Catapult Learning required plans and reports are maintained and updated properly.

- Must reside on the island of Oahu full-time
- Bachelor’s degree
- At least two years teaching experience at the primary and/or secondary level
- At least two years related supervisory experience in education
- Must be able to teach all basic skills or other related areas and interact with students and administrators.
- Has the ability to handle multiple priorities and travel between multiple school sites. Must understand that all children can learn.
- Must have a valid state driver's license and own a personal vehicle to transport self to different sites
- Must demonstrate a positive and enthusiastic attitude towards internal and external customers. Must be flexible.
- Proficient working knowledge of Microsoft Office, including Outlook, is a must.
